Early Life and Lineage of Amanda Kate Lambert
Growing Up in Hollywood Royalty
Amanda Kate Lambert was born on March 17, 1976. She grew up in Los Angeles surrounded by music history. Her mother, Nancy Sinatra, was a global pop sensation. Her father, Hugh Lambert, was a talented producer and choreographer. Despite their immense fame, her parents provided a grounded home. They encouraged personal expression over commercial success.
Tragedy struck in 1985 when her father died of cancer. Amanda Kate Lambert was only nine years old. This loss brought the family even closer together. She grew up alongside her sister, Angela Jennifer “AJ” Lambert. Surrounded by art and vinyl records, Amanda developed a eye for detail. Visual expression became her natural comfort zone.

Preserving the Sinatra Legacy: Archival and Curation Work
Unearthing the Sinatra Family Archives
Amanda Kate Lambert also acts as her family’s primary archivist. Over decades, her family collected thousands of unreleased photos. These items sat unorganized in private storage. She took on the task of scanning and restoring the collection. She preserved these items for future generations.
During this work, Amanda Kate Lambert found incredible historical treasures. She discovered rare self-portraits taken by Frank Sinatra in 1938. She also found candid shots from movie sets and family events. Her work transformed mess into a museum-grade archive.
The Official Centennial Book Project
Her archival work culminated in 2015 for Frank Sinatra’s centennial birthday. Amanda Kate Lambert served as chief curator for the book SINATRA. This massive 400-page luxury book required years of research. It features rare private photos and essays from stars like Martin Scorsese.
The book received widespread praise from critics and historians. Amanda Kate Lambert presented a balanced view of her grandfather. She showed both his public genius and his private warmth. The project proved her skills as a professional curator.
